Justification:
- Normally, the primary key, foreign key and not null constraints are used to enforce total participation constraints on a many-to-many relationship on the relations created from the relationship.
- However, in Structured Query Language (SQL) total participation constraints on a many-to-many relationship can’t be enforced on the relations created from the relationship because, they have to be embodied as separate relation that will not be combined with either of the participating entities...
